Output d323b62606cc46583aaf0671bfefe839288cab1eb6d130217ba6edd4533d8e23:44

value
67108864
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 17c5c99187b3e271d21b656ee43fcfbd4d783080ab0c489e75336d1d91054f42
address
bc1pzlzunyv8k038r5smv4hwg070h4xhsvyq4vxy38n4xdk3myg9fapqd30p05
transaction
d323b62606cc46583aaf0671bfefe839288cab1eb6d130217ba6edd4533d8e23
spent
true